OpenStudy (mathmate):

Hint: Whenever you solve an equation involving log, you need to substitute back into the equation to reject all roots that make log negative (recall dom log(x)=(0,inf) ).

OpenStudy (mathmate):

@Nnesha yes, the solution x=2 is correct for the algebraic part, but not correct for the problem given!
